A business bio is a concise and engaging description of a company or organization. It typically includes information about the company’s history, mission, values, and products or services. A well-written business bio can help to attract new customers, build trust with existing customers, and improve the company’s overall brand image.
There are many benefits to writing a strong business bio. For example, a business bio can help to:
- Increase brand awareness
- Generate leads
- Improve customer loyalty
- Boost sales
When writing a business bio, it is important to keep the following in mind:
- Keep it concise. A business bio should be no more than 200 words.
- Use strong verbs. Verbs are the workhorses of a sentence, and they can help to make your bio more engaging.
- Use specific details. Don’t just say that your company is “the best.” Instead, provide specific examples of what makes your company unique.
- Proofread carefully. Make sure your bio is free of errors before you publish it.

2. Compelling
When writing a business bio, it is important to use strong verbs and specific details to make your bio engaging. Strong verbs are action words that help to create a vivid picture in the reader’s mind. Specific details help to provide context and make your bio more memorable.
For example, instead of saying “We provide excellent customer service,” you could say “We go the extra mile to ensure that our customers are happy.” This is a more engaging and specific way to describe your customer service.
Here are some other tips for using strong verbs and specific details in your business bio:
- Use active voice instead of passive voice.
- Use specific nouns and adjectives.
- Avoid using jargon or technical terms.
- Proofread your bio carefully before publishing it.
By following these tips, you can write a business bio that is compelling and engaging.

Tips for Writing a Business Bio
Crafting an effective business bio is essential for establishing a strong brand identity and attracting potential customers. Here are some tips to guide you in writing a compelling business bio:
Tip 1: Define Your Target Audience
Identify the specific group of individuals or businesses you want to reach with your bio. Understanding their interests, demographics, and pain points will help you tailor your message effectively.
Tip 2: Highlight Your Unique Value Proposition
Emphasize what sets your business apart from competitors. Clearly articulate the unique benefits and solutions you offer to meet the specific needs of your target audience.
Tip 3: Use Strong and Action-Oriented Language
Avoid passive voice and opt for verbs that convey action and impact. Use specific and quantifiable examples to demonstrate your accomplishments and the value you deliver.
Tip 4: Keep it Concise and Engaging
Aim for a bio that is around 200-300 words long. Break up your text into digestible paragraphs and use bullet points to enhance readability.
Tip 5: Proofread Carefully
Ensure that your bio is free of grammatical errors, spelling mistakes, and inconsistencies. Request feedback from colleagues or a professional editor to guarantee a polished and error-free presentation.
Tip 6: Include a Call to Action
Motivate readers to take the next step by including a clear call to action. Whether it’s visiting your website, scheduling a consultation, or following your social media pages, provide a straightforward way for interested parties to connect with you.
By following these tips, you can craft a business bio that effectively communicates your brand’s identity, value proposition, and call to action. Remember to regularly review and update your bio to reflect your business’s growth and evolving offerings.
